Why you should hire a virtual assistant.


Your blog is hopping, your inbox is full, you have laundry to do, and kids to feed (or fur babies!).  What is a busy one-women-operation to do?  

I know many small handmade businesses feel like they don't have the funds available to hire someone to help out with the tasks that are taking up their time in the day that need to get done but take away from the time you could be spending on the things you really love, the whole reason you started your business your passions.  But look at it this way, the small investment you can make in your business can make a huge impact to push your business to the next level.  


Virtual Assistants are a great, low cost investment that can truly help your business.  When you team up with the right person who cares about you and wants to see your business succeed you both win and everyone is happy.  Plus bonus a virtual assistant is a small business too, so that means you are getting the good parts of an "employee" but without the taxes, vacation and sick days!  Woot!

Ok sounds great right, you are ready now how the heck do you find this magical wonderful being that will take away all the mundane tasks and leave you to craft until your heart is full.... Well first off there is me :D  but if my schedule is full or we aren't the right fit here are a few ways to find Virtual Assistant (VA) of your dreams!


  • Ask your crafty circle, most VAs are hired from word of mouth. Are you in a network forum of other successful small businesses, an Etsy group, a Facebook group?  This is a great source of information and contacts! 

  • Have a good following on Facebook?  Post a "want ad" there, I promise you, you will get responses, you may have to weed through them but you will get someone out there that would love to work with you.  Same goes for posting a want ad on your blog if you have a readership.  Time and time again when bloggers post they are looking for help within 24-48 they have to close the application window due to a large amount of applicants.  

  • Google is your friend, you found my site right?  Many probably from a google search!  Here are some key words: Virtual Assistant, VA, Small Business, handmade, artist.  You get the idea!
